Sha256: c13ca9de54747f91eb9c1ba2a5e149a26c19fcc5d9838a5725da3ceb55dc8f45

Contents?: true

Size: 550 Bytes

Versions: 6

Compression:

Stored size: 550 Bytes

Contents

# frozen_string_literal: true

require_relative "process_adapters"
require_relative "process_predicates"
require_relative "process_paging"
require_relative "process_sorting"
require_relative "process_filters"

module Trailblazer
  class Finder
    module Activities
      class Process < Trailblazer::Activity::Railway
        step Subprocess(ProcessAdapters)
        step Subprocess(ProcessPredicates)
        step Subprocess(ProcessFilters)
        step Subprocess(ProcessPaging)
        step Subprocess(ProcessSorting)
      end
    end
  end
end

Version data entries

6 entries across 6 versions & 1 rubygems

Version Path
trailblazer-finder-0.92.0 lib/trailblazer/finder/activities/process.rb
trailblazer-finder-0.91.0 lib/trailblazer/finder/activities/process.rb
trailblazer-finder-0.90.0 lib/trailblazer/finder/activities/process.rb
trailblazer-finder-0.80.1 lib/trailblazer/finder/activities/process.rb
trailblazer-finder-0.70.0 lib/trailblazer/finder/activities/process.rb
trailblazer-finder-0.50.0 lib/trailblazer/finder/activities/process.rb